🏡 Welcome to my August Market Update 🏡

Following on from an interesting update in July where the Maidenhead market continued to move this month, we are starting to see the impact of the summer holidays take affect on out market ☀️
 
🫣 Only 236 new properties came on the market in July VS 266 in June! 
This will be because some families have gone away at the end of July and might wait till the kids are back at school in September to launch their properties. 
 
📉 Naturally because less properties were launched in Maidenhead less properties sold in July 117 vs June 145 ⬇️
 
But a very similar amount of properties reduced in price meaning owners are recognising that they may have been over priced and its time to get to the right price now Reduced 152 – 150 – The question is have they reduced enough to beat the next interest rate rise from tomorrow❓
 
🥳 These are the highlights of my July where these fantastic two properties sold, Bramble Drive – Taken off another agent and listed at the correct price to sell, and Highfield Lane has finally sold again 🙏

🥰 Ive also got this amazing property coming to the market in Ockwells Park. that as of today has 13 People booked in to view, showing that even with high interest rates the market is active.
 
🤦‍♂️ If a property valuation seems to good to be true then maybe it is. Most property prices are reducing between 1-5% (especially if you need work)

Cippenham's private rental market has changed considerably over the last five years. In 2021, the average monthly rent in Cippenham was £1,086. So far in 2026, that figure stands at £1,475. That is a rise of 35.8%. To put that into context, the average UK rent increased from £1,390 in 2021 to £1,744 in 2026, a rise of 25.5%.

Stevenage's private rental market has changed considerably over the last five years. In 2021, the average monthly rent in Stevenage was £1,029. So far in 2026, that figure stands at £1,377. That is a rise of 33.8%. To put that into context, the average UK rent increased from £1,390 in 2021 to £1,744 in 2026, a rise of 25.5%.
